520 |a This study investigates the students' pronunciation profile in producing the segmental and suprasegmental features in a scripted speech. This research involved fifteen of 4th semester English Department students who took Speaking in Academic Purposes 1 course. The methodology employed in this research was a qualitative research design. The data were collected through students speaking performance videos in Flipgrid by transcribing and converting the video into IPA transcriptions. The result of this research revealed that students have difficulty producing consonants, vowels, and diphthongs by substituting the targeted sound with similar sound; also, they replaced the word stress into a wrong syllable. This study expected to help both students and teachers to find a proper strategy in pronunciation instruction. Studying the student's pronunciation profile enables teachers to have a better understanding of the areas where students face the most difficult in delivering a speech.
